Latest Patents

Haisheng Zhou holds a patent for a groundbreaking invention titled "0-10 volt dimming for AC-powered LED lights." This patent describes a circuitry system designed to control the dimming of a load circuit. The system connects a 0-10 V dimmer that outputs a DC voltage control signal to the load circuit. It incorporates a microcontroller programmed to generate a pulse-width modulated (PWM) signal, which adjusts the duty cycle based on the dimming level set on the dimmer. Additionally, a voltage conversion circuit supplies the microcontroller with data regarding the set dimming level. The microcontroller synchronizes the PWM signal with the supplied AC power, allowing for precise control over the dimming process.
